Patent number: 12168422Abstract: The deploying stepway includes a guide frame and a step assembly. The step assembly includes a plurality of steps, a step frame pivotally coupled to the steps and including a pivot assembly, and a proximal portion and a distal portion defined on either side of the pivot assembly. The deploying stepway is configured to transition among a stair configuration, in which the proximal and distal portions are aligned and extend from the guide frame at a declined stair angle, a ladder configuration in which the distal portion is pivoted relative to the proximal portion and extends from the guide frame at a declined ladder angle, and a stowed configuration in which the step assembly is at least substantially received in the guide frame. The methods include deploying the deploying stepway from the stowed to the stair configuration and transitioning the deploying stepway from the stowed to the ladder configuration.Type: GrantFiled: March 29, 2022Date of Patent: December 17, 2024Assignee: Globe Trekker, LLCInventors: William Myron Sands, II, Garrett Pauwels

Patent number: 9027711Abstract: Self-locking bi-foldable load bearing segments are disclosed that can be used in applications such as ladders or ramp. First and second sections of the segment are foldably coupled to transition between an open configuration and a folded configuration. The first and second sections can include rungs pivotally attached to rails that can be further transitioned from the folded configuration to a collapsed configuration, but not transitioned from the open configuration to the collapsed configuration. Openings in the side walls of the rails allow the rungs to pivot in one direction, but not an opposite direction. In the open configuration, the openings of the first and second sections may be oriented opposite, and the direction of allowed rotation of the rungs of the first section and second section are opposite, restricting compression of the rails together.Type: GrantFiled: August 31, 2011Date of Patent: May 12, 2015Assignee: Ardisam, Inc.Inventors: Brendan Lonergan, Michael R. Patent number: 8381873Abstract: A convertible ladder and scaffold assembly includes a plurality of uprights and a plurality of beams each extending from one of the uprights. A plurality of hinges each hingedly connect one of the uprights to one of the beams about a rotational axis (AR) to provide an assembly having ladder, scaffold, push-cart, and storage configurations. Each of the hinges defines catches and present a stop releasably engaging catches for preventing rotation about the rotational axis (AR). At least one lever bar releasably engages a plurality of the stops for simultaneously releasing a plurality of the stops from engaging catches. Each of the lever bars have a plurality of lever sections for providing leverage to disengage the stops from the catches. Each of the lever bars has a grip section interconnecting the lever sections for simultaneously releasing a plurality of the stops from engaging the catches.Type: GrantFiled: July 28, 2010Date of Patent: February 26, 2013Assignee: Affinity Tool WorksInventors: Mark Cross, Eric Primeau

Patent number: 6719093Abstract: An extension ladder and tree stand for supporting a seated or standing person on an elevated platform against a tree trunk for hunting, photography, and the like. The ladder and platform collapse into a compact size and shape for carrying by a person. The ladder is in telescoping sections. Alternate steps of the ladder slide to the middle of each telescoping section. This provides twice as many steps as sections, reducing the number of telescoping sections by half. This minimizes weight, size, complexity, and expense. When deployed, all parts remain safely assembled in all positions. Captive spring loaded pins fix the telescoping sections in extended or retracted positions, and fix the sliding steps in a middle position of each section. A folding seat on the platform has a cushion that reconfigures into a back cushion for carrying the collapsed assembly on the back of a person.Type: GrantFiled: February 1, 2002Date of Patent: April 13, 2004Inventor: Michael R.
